Description
Overview
If you enjoy building deep infrastructure systems where networking, storage, kernel behavior, and performance all intersect — this is the kind of role that rarely comes along.
At DDN, we build infrastructure for some of the world’s most demanding AI, HPC, and large-scale data environments. We are looking for a Senior / Staff Fuse Developer who wants to work close to the systems layer — where file systems, object storage, RDMA networking, and Linux kernel behavior directly impact performance at scale.
This is not a role for someone who only consumes infrastructure. It is for engineers who understand how data moves through the stack, who care about latency and throughput, and who enjoy solving hard systems problems deep inside storage and Linux environments.
Job Description
Why this role is compelling
At DDN, you will work on infrastructure challenges that sit at the core of modern high-performance systems:
Building and optimizing FUSE-based file system technologies
Working across Linux kernel file systems and user-space infrastructure layers
Designing high-performance infrastructure for distributed storage environments
Improving how object storage systems behave under real production workloads
Working with RDMA networking principles and high-speed data movement
Solving performance bottlenecks across networking, storage, and I/O pathways
Developing systems-level infrastructure in C and C++
Building platforms that support AI, HPC, and large-scale data-intensive workloads
Your work will directly influence how large-scale infrastructure platforms perform in real-world production environments — not just in theory.
What you’ll do
Design, build, and optimize FUSE-based infrastructure and storage components
Develop and improve Linux file system integrations across kernel and user-space layers
Work on distributed storage and object storage infrastructure systems
Improve scalability, resiliency, and performance across storage platforms
Optimize networking and data movement using RDMA principles
Diagnose bottlenecks across file systems, networking, memory, and I/O stacks
Develop infrastructure tooling and platform capabilities in C and C++
Work closely with systems, storage, and platform engineering teams on deeply technical infrastructure challenges
Help shape next-generation infrastructure platforms for AI and high-performance environments
What we’re looking for
Strong hands-on experience developing with FUSE and Linux file systems
Deep understanding of Linux kernel file system architecture
Strong programming skills in C and C++
Strong understanding of POSIX file system principles
Experience with object storage systems and distributed infrastructure
Familiarity with RDMA networking principles and high-speed networking technologies
Experience working close to kernel-space and user-space I/O paths
Strong systems mindset with the ability to debug complex infrastructure and performance issues
Experience building or optimizing infrastructure platforms in production environments
You’ll thrive here if
You enjoy low-level systems and infrastructure engineering
You care deeply about performance, scale, and reliability
You like solving technical problems that most engineers avoid because they are too deep or performance-sensitive
You enjoy understanding how storage and networking behave under pressure
You prefer working close to the metal instead of purely abstracted application layers
You want to build infrastructure that directly powers mission-critical environments
This role is probably not for you if
Your background is primarily application-layer or general backend development
You have limited experience with Linux internals, file systems, or infrastructure engineering
You prefer higher-level platform abstraction over systems-level development
You have not worked on performance-sensitive distributed systems
You want a coordination-heavy role rather than deep technical ownership
Salary Range: $150,000 - $250,000
